The University of Colorado was founded in 1876 on the plains of Boulder, Colorado.  It all started with one building.  In the time since, it has expanded to include over one hundred buildings.  As one can imagine, the growth of the University has had an extreme effect on the environment around it.  The landscape has gone from one of grass and shrubs to one of concrete and planted trees.  This project examines the changes on campus from a completely permeable environment to an environment that has become for a large part impermeable.

The area being mapped is highlighted by the red square on the left.  It is the area including Hellems, Education, Denison, and University Collections.
